is it true that jd byrider puts gps tracking device in your car incase you dont pay? (what is your source?) i have always paid on time. i dont plan on not paying. that is not the issue but i feel weird about them being able to tell where i’m at always.

Best Answer: They could if they wanted the expense. Nothing would prohibit them from knowing the whereabouts of their collateral at any given time. In the “old days’ ; banker sthat loaned on “movable property” ; would “visit” their collateral to make sure “those cows were still there”. Even grain is microchipped today to identify ownership of certain contaniers. Many frieght vans (trailers) have GPS devices on them, so that the owners of the freight know where their property is located. Until it is paid for and the lein released, it remains the collateral (for the loan) and the lender has an interest in the property. They don’t care where you are, just the property.
